Texto completoIn the late middle ages the barony of montmorillon covered an area of about 1000 square kilometers and its economy (consisting mostly in breeding) was an average one in spite of the difficulties of the time. It was composed of a hundred and ten fiefs. There stood twenty seven castles. Montmorillon has got an archpriest. Fifteen castles are still standing in perfect or poor condition. Four of them were built in the xivth century, such as la ferrandiere and pruniers. The others were erected in the xvth century ; we can underline the interest of forges, bourg-archambault and champeau. Created because the people of that time were afraid, and the symbol of a social class, the castle in the montmorillon area was financed by the gentry, with the warrant of the king or without it ; built by local masters, who were themselves influenced by the ones in poitiers, it was kept by the population around. It could protect only against gangs of armed men. Standing on various sites, it has got a plan organized around a dwelling or a keep. It is a model counterpart of the great castle : an enceinte, towers, a chapel, a dwelling or a keep are to be found there ; its decoration, which is rather rich, obviously improved in the second half of the xvth century. When considered in the context of its time, the little castle can be looked upon as a building devoided of any major archeological originality in comparaison with the other countries except for one : the square keep flanked with four turrets projecting out, a type the pattern of which is the keep of vincennes and the "tour maubergeon" in poitiers. It must be neatly differentiated from the fortified house. In each of its elements (its architecture, its decoration), it is a modest duplicate of the great constructions of the late middle ages

Texto completoThe western bas-languedoc, as in other regions in france, has witressed the proliferation of a multitude of the eve of world war one. This research tries to characterise this group of "chateaux" which fit in perfectly with the architectural ideology of the period by means of a study on styles and - what is more difficult to establish- on the architects who, for the most part are unknown or have been forgotten. This construc- tions hifghlight the vast wine-producing estates which are very often rich in history in the beziers and aude areas. Their achievement was made possible due to a specific economic phonomenon linked to the wineyards: the scourge of oidium and phylloxera which spared this area, whilst devastating the rest of the herault department, allowed beziers and narbonne to become the sole wine producers for several years during which permitted the great landowners to accumulate considerable fortunes. At the head of the true wine-producing concerns ever since, the beziers and aude upper middle classes had its urban habitations renovated and had sumptuous country dwellings built, symbols of its quasi-aristocratic power, in order to accomodate a highly fashonable lifestyle

Texto completoThis work has for object the study of alsatian mountain castles, confronted to siege war determined by introduction and development of fire arms. It is the study of the material frame, where we observe a certain spring of mountain castles. Their architecture isn't throw down by the new arms. Constancies subsist. Empiric modifications of the art of siege involve slow and progressive transformations of the castle. It's also the study of a political context, into wich castle is included. More than never, it is the instrument and stake of concurrent ambitions, of territories in way of strengthening and organization in the alsatian ending middle ages and beginning modern epoch. Examination of general data and more detailled approach through four significant examples (haut-koenigsbourg, haut-barr, herrenstein, schoeneck) make appear all these aspects
